Singapore-based label In Good Company is finally in Manila!

Straight from Singapore, In Good Company (IGC) launches in the country today, bringing in its neo-modern aesthetic that reinterprets classic silhouettes with a modern twist.

A go-to label for anything that's accessible, wearable, and free-spirited, IGC was forged in 2012 by four friends one work night. Sven Tan and Kane Tan are the creatives holding the Creative Director and Chief of Design positions respectively. On the other hand, Jackyn Teo and Julene Aw run the mechanical part of the enterprise. Together, the quartet offers a modern take on closet favorites elevated with quirky details and impeccable craftsmanship.

In the sea of fast fashion, it's not easy for a newbie brand to make noise. That said, they chose to launch their business with a curated 40-piece collection, which later on became their standard system for releasing new pieces. By announcing capsules, they approach the ready-to-wear market free from the dictates of trends and fashion seasons.

IGC prefers not to rush their creative or manufacture legs and opts to release new items quarterly or bi-monthly. It enables them to offer well-thought modern essentials for their consumers. But apart from becoming independent in terms of design, IGC also puts focus on the technology behind the clothes and its fabrications. They make sure that their pieces are sturdy yet suitable for tropical climates.

The brand opens in the city with Capsule 11 that Sven describes to have "explored new shapes and draping techniques that create more movement and dimensionality, as well as new hardware such as oversized grommets, hanging ties, and d-rings that give the capsule a modern utilitarian look, in an ultra-wearable way.” 

Additionally, the collection injects sharp, modern, fluid silhouettes with technical detailing and visual panels, an obvious nod to the retro years. It also offers a new perspective on workwear while breaking down formal dress codes and, at the same time, redefining and refining casualwear.

It also includes an array of accessories like necklaces inspired by nature, more specifically constellations and florals. All the necklaces are hand assembled and finished with hand stitches.

In Good Company's Capsule 11 is available now in stores. Prices range from P3885 to P8985 for tops; P2885 to P5485 for necklaces; P6985 to P9,985 dresses; P3885 to P9485 for bottoms; and P7485 to P9985 for jackets. They are located at the Level 2 of The SM Store Makati.
